A CloudSim Extension for Evaluating Security Overhead in Workflow Execution in Clouds
Creators
- 1. Universidade de São Paulo
- 2. University of Leicester
Description
Workflow scheduling algorithms for cloud environments are extensively studied using workflow management system simulators. The common criteria covered by algorithms and addressed in simulators are makespan, monetary cost, reliability, and energy consumption. Beyond these criteria, security is also a criterion and has been investigated recently. Scientific and business workflows typically handle sensitive and big data that can influence the makespan and cost significantly when a scheduling algorithm applies security services to these data. However, simulators for workflow execution do not address the overhead produced by applying security services to sensitive data. In this paper, we propose an extension for workflow simulator to support security services. We considered seven steps for measuring security overheads on workflow execution. The extension was validated by executing a real-world workflow applying three types of security services namely authentication, integrity verification, and encryption. Our extension proved useful for simulating workflow execution applying security services on sensitive data and analyzing the effects of security on makespan, cost and security criteria.
Translated Descriptions
Translated Description (Arabic)
تتم دراسة خوارزميات جدولة سير العمل للبيئات السحابية على نطاق واسع باستخدام محاكيات نظام إدارة سير العمل. المعايير الشائعة التي تغطيها الخوارزميات والتي يتم تناولها في أجهزة المحاكاة هي makespan، والتكلفة النقدية، والموثوقية، واستهلاك الطاقة. بالإضافة إلى هذه المعايير، يعد الأمن أيضًا معيارًا وقد تم التحقيق فيه مؤخرًا. عادةً ما تتعامل سير العمل العلمي والتجاري مع البيانات الحساسة والكبيرة التي يمكن أن تؤثر على العمر الافتراضي وتكلفتها بشكل كبير عندما تطبق خوارزمية الجدولة خدمات الأمان على هذه البيانات. ومع ذلك، فإن أجهزة المحاكاة لتنفيذ سير العمل لا تعالج النفقات العامة الناتجة عن تطبيق خدمات الأمان على البيانات الحساسة. في هذه الورقة، نقترح تمديدًا لمحاكي سير العمل لدعم الخدمات الأمنية. لقد نظرنا في سبع خطوات لقياس النفقات العامة الأمنية على تنفيذ سير العمل. تم التحقق من صحة التمديد من خلال تنفيذ سير عمل حقيقي يطبق ثلاثة أنواع من خدمات الأمان وهي المصادقة والتحقق من النزاهة والتشفير. أثبت امتدادنا أنه مفيد لمحاكاة تنفيذ سير العمل وتطبيق خدمات الأمان على البيانات الحساسة وتحليل آثار الأمان على معايير التصميم والتكلفة والأمان.Translated Description (French)
Les algorithmes de planification des flux de travail pour les environnements cloud sont largement étudiés à l'aide de simulateurs de système de gestion des flux de travail. Les critères communs couverts par les algorithmes et abordés dans les simulateurs sont le makepan, le coût monétaire, la fiabilité et la consommation d'énergie. Au-delà de ces critères, la sécurité est également un critère et a fait l'objet d'une enquête récente. Les flux de travail scientifiques et commerciaux traitent généralement des données sensibles et volumineuses qui peuvent influencer la portée et le coût de manière significative lorsqu'un algorithme de planification applique des services de sécurité à ces données. Cependant, les simulateurs pour l'exécution du flux de travail ne traitent pas les frais généraux produits par l'application de services de sécurité aux données sensibles. Dans cet article, nous proposons une extension pour le simulateur de workflow pour prendre en charge les services de sécurité. Nous avons envisagé sept étapes pour mesurer les frais généraux de sécurité sur l'exécution du flux de travail. L'extension a été validée en exécutant un flux de travail réel appliquant trois types de services de sécurité, à savoir l'authentification, la vérification de l'intégrité et le cryptage. Notre extension s'est avérée utile pour simuler l'exécution du flux de travail en appliquant des services de sécurité sur des données sensibles et en analysant les effets de la sécurité sur les critères de makepan, de coût et de sécurité.Translated Description (Spanish)
Los algoritmos de programación de flujos de trabajo para entornos en la nube se estudian exhaustivamente utilizando simuladores de sistemas de gestión de flujos de trabajo. Los criterios comunes cubiertos por los algoritmos y abordados en los simuladores son la duración, el coste monetario, la fiabilidad y el consumo de energía. Más allá de estos criterios, la seguridad también es un criterio y se ha investigado recientemente. Los flujos de trabajo científicos y comerciales generalmente manejan datos confidenciales y grandes que pueden influir significativamente en el makepan y el costo cuando un algoritmo de programación aplica servicios de seguridad a estos datos. Sin embargo, los simuladores para la ejecución del flujo de trabajo no abordan la sobrecarga producida por la aplicación de servicios de seguridad a datos confidenciales. En este documento, proponemos una extensión para el simulador de flujo de trabajo para respaldar los servicios de seguridad. Consideramos siete pasos para medir los gastos generales de seguridad en la ejecución del flujo de trabajo. La extensión se validó ejecutando un flujo de trabajo del mundo real aplicando tres tipos de servicios de seguridad: autenticación, verificación de integridad y cifrado. Nuestra extensión demostró ser útil para simular la ejecución del flujo de trabajo aplicando servicios de seguridad en datos confidenciales y analizando los efectos de la seguridad en los criterios de makepan, costo y seguridad.Files
      
        18435056.pdf.pdf
        
      
    
    
      
        Files
         (353.2 kB)
        
      
    
    | Name | Size | Download all | 
|---|---|---|
| md5:102b996b965a4303269a92b54eee6a86 | 353.2 kB | Preview Download | 
Additional details
Additional titles
- Translated title (Arabic)
- ملحق CloudSim لتقييم النفقات العامة الأمنية في تنفيذ سير العمل في السحابة
- Translated title (French)
- Une extension CloudSim pour évaluer les frais généraux de sécurité dans l'exécution des workflows dans les clouds
- Translated title (Spanish)
- Una extensión de CloudSim para evaluar la sobrecarga de seguridad en la ejecución del flujo de trabajo en las nubes
Identifiers
- Other
- https://openalex.org/W2907054227
- DOI
- 10.1109/candar.2018.00031
            
              References
            
          
        - https://openalex.org/W122889433
- https://openalex.org/W1983833794
- https://openalex.org/W1986421100
- https://openalex.org/W2000899545
- https://openalex.org/W2021572863
- https://openalex.org/W2045287414
- https://openalex.org/W2051644464
- https://openalex.org/W2078962046
- https://openalex.org/W2112967367
- https://openalex.org/W2114296561
- https://openalex.org/W2135584912
- https://openalex.org/W2154513453
- https://openalex.org/W2154876715
- https://openalex.org/W2223334459
- https://openalex.org/W2557004849
- https://openalex.org/W2561389184
- https://openalex.org/W2779294360
- https://openalex.org/W2891065101
- https://openalex.org/W2897634503